Mercurial
diff third_party/emsdk/docker/test_dockerimage.sh @ 186:8cf4ec5e2191 hg-web
Fixed merge conflict.
| author | MrJuneJune <me@mrjunejune.com> |
|---|---|
| date | Fri, 23 Jan 2026 22:38:59 -0800 |
| parents | 8d17f6e6e290 |
| children |
line wrap: on
line diff
--- /dev/null Thu Jan 01 00:00:00 1970 +0000 +++ b/third_party/emsdk/docker/test_dockerimage.sh Fri Jan 23 22:38:59 2026 -0800 @@ -0,0 +1,29 @@ +#!/usr/bin/env bash +set -ex + +if [ $EUID -eq 0 ]; then + sudo -u nobody `which emcc` --version +fi + +which emsdk +node --version +npm --version +python3 --version +pip3 --version +em++ --version +emcc --version +java -version +cmake --version + +exit_code=0 + +# test emcc compilation +echo 'int main() { return 0; }' | emcc -o /tmp/main.js -xc - +node /tmp/main.js || exit_code=$? +if [ $exit_code -ne 0 ]; then + echo "Node exited with non-zero exit code: $exit_code" + exit $exit_code +fi + +# test embuilder +embuilder build zlib --force